Core Viewpoint - The article discusses the environmental impact of fiberglass-reinforced plastic (GRP) boats, highlighting the pollution caused by abandoned vessels and the microplastics released during maintenance processes, which pose risks to marine life and human health [1][5][19]. Group 1: Historical Context and Material Properties - Fiberglass-reinforced plastic (GRP) emerged in the mid-20th century, consisting of fine glass fibers and resin, becoming popular in the shipbuilding industry due to its lightweight, strength, and corrosion resistance [3]. - In Brazil, the rise of recreational boating and fishing led to the launch of thousands of GRP boats, which were initially favored for their durability compared to wood and steel [5]. Group 2: Environmental Concerns - By the 21st century, many GRP boats reached retirement, but their disposal is costly and technically challenging, leading to many owners abandoning them in remote areas, resulting in numerous "zombie boats" in Guanabara Bay [6]. - Even operational boats contribute to pollution through maintenance processes, where anti-fouling paints containing heavy metals and biocides are used, leading to the release of harmful particles into the water [8][10]. Group 3: Impact on Marine Life - Research indicates that marine bivalves, such as oysters, ingest microplastics and fiberglass particles, with studies showing up to 11,220 glass fiber micro-particles per kilogram of oyster meat during peak maintenance seasons [12][14]. - The ingestion of these sharp fibers can cause severe inflammation in bivalves, leading to health issues and nutritional deficiencies due to a false sense of satiety from consuming indigestible materials [16][18]. Group 4: Human Health Implications - The presence of microplastics in seafood raises concerns for human consumers, as these particles may carry toxic substances like lead, copper, and phthalates, which can disrupt endocrine systems [19]. - The ongoing pollution from ship maintenance practices poses a growing threat, as particles are detected in various marine environments, indicating widespread contamination [21].
麦加芯彩(603062):Q1业绩同比显著提升,风电涂料业务快速增长
Tianfeng Securities· 2025-05-08 07:13
Investment Rating - The investment rating for the company is "Buy" with a target price set for the next six months [5][16]. Core Views - The company reported significant year-on-year growth in Q1 2025, with revenue reaching 424 million yuan, a 40.5% increase, and net profit attributable to shareholders at 50 million yuan, up 77.4% [1][2]. - The wind power coating business experienced rapid growth, contributing to the overall revenue increase alongside stable demand in the container business [1][2]. - The company aims to strengthen its position in the container and wind power coating sectors while expanding into new applications such as marine, photovoltaic, offshore engineering, energy storage, and data centers [3]. Financial Performance - In Q1 2025, the company's total coating production was 22,800 tons, a 22.9% increase year-on-year, with sales volumes for container coatings, wind power coatings, and other industrial coatings at 19,006 tons, 3,617 tons, and 46 tons respectively [2]. - The average selling prices for container coatings, wind power coatings, and other industrial coatings were 16,200 yuan/ton, 31,600 yuan/ton, and 20,700 yuan/ton, reflecting year-on-year changes of +9.8%, -11.9%, and +7.8% respectively [2]. - The gross profit for Q1 2025 was 104 million yuan, a 63.9% increase, with a comprehensive gross margin of 23.8%, up 3.4 percentage points year-on-year [2]. Future Outlook - The company is expected to see continued growth in net profit, with projections of 260.5 million yuan, 318.4 million yuan, and 391.7 million yuan for 2025, 2026, and 2027 respectively [3][4]. - The anticipated delivery period for wind power projects in 2025 is expected to further boost the company's product sales [2]. - The company has made strategic acquisitions and certifications, such as obtaining the DNV anti-fouling paint certification, which will help expand its market presence in marine coatings [3].
